Originally Posted by fireboatpilot
32' Hydra Cat, twin 540's 700hp each. So far got 108 out of it at maybe 70 percent throttle. Running out of gear with 1:50 lowers and 36P props. After dropping the gears to 1:34 and re-proping we should be in the 115-120range. WHY?
FBP - how do you tell when you're "running out of gear"? I haven't been able to get a good grasp as to which gear set you should run and why. I get it in a car, but it all seems to work out as equal on a boat.
